
The theory of relativity is one of the most significant scientific developments of the 20th century and was developed by Albert Einstein. This theory redefined the concepts of space and time under conditions of high velocities and strong gravitational fields where Newtonian mechanics proved inadequate. The Einstein ring is a special case of the gravitational lensing effect. It occurs when light from a more distant light source, aligned with a massive celestial object (such as a galaxy or a black hole), is bent by the gravitational influence of this object, resulting in the light appearing as a perfect ring in the observer's field of view.
